Defining the reasonable gap between each parts of vehicle and the vehicles, is advantageous to avoiding vehicle to generate an interference in the run-time, and raise vehicle run-time performance. In order to raise the level of our country vehicle's research, design and production, this text is on the basis of computational multibody systems dynamics and parametric technique theoretic, make use of menu and dialogue box editor and macro command method, deliver a simulation system for relative position of endface connection device at ADAMS/Rail software platen and ADAMS command language environment.In the run-time, when the train is subjected to traction, braking action or passing curve, turnout and variable-point, between each parts of vehicle and two close cars, all can generate relative running. This text analyzed the mathematics principle of relative location of the endface connection device and the theory of computational multibody systems dynamics of the virtual model machine.Through the analysis characteristics of virtual machine product applied by railroad vehicle, this text select ADAMS/Rail for a platform of relative location of the endface connection device simulator system, it is an excellent kinetics analysis software. Owing to the thorough search for common method to the second developing, it select the command language environment in ADAMS, making use of menu and dialogue box editor and macro order method to progress the second developing.Based on "The template create- subsystem create-train system assemble" mode that adopted by ADAMS/Rail, created some template and subsystem of the car body, bogie and line, they are stored in the catalog document in correspond with the second develops system by databases form and can be convenient to use while train assembly.According to the command language, custom menu and dialogue box to develop the interface of the relative location of the endface connection device simulator system, the system has a good interface of humancomputer and fault tolerant capability, can choose the car body, bogie, coupler, lines conveniently on your own, can automatically assemble two car train system, and carry on a modification for car body, bogie shape size and attribute document conveniently. At the same time pass create a specific request, can carry on opposite location of car port and vehicle kinetics performance analysis.
